Core Planning Reasoning
The development was recommended for grant as it complies with the Z1 zoning objective, aligns with the established character of the area, and does not significantly impact the visual or residential amenities of neighboring properties.
Decision Maker's Conclusion
- The proposed extensions are consistent with the residential zoning objective and the established architectural pattern of the streetscape.
- Impacts on neighboring residential amenities, particularly overshadowing and privacy at No. 86, are deemed acceptable and within reasonable planning limits.
- The design elements, including the front extension and rear dormer, are visually subordinate to the main dwelling and follow existing local precedents.

Decision Document Summary
The application at 88 Clancy Road, Finglas, proposed a single-storey front extension, a two-storey side extension, and an attic conversion with a rear dormer. The site is located in a residential area zoned 'Z1' under the Dublin City Development Plan 2016-2022. Third-party appellants at No. 86 raised concerns regarding overshadowing, breach of the building line, and loss of privacy.
